[QUOTE="Agback, post: 2892078, member: 5328"] Make the plane a nuclear-armed bomber, to help the military create a public flap, and justify such precautions as evacuating the town and erecting a cordon. I would be tempted to put some sort of nuctear emergency teams on all the approach roads, but I'm not sure that Briatin has such. I would put lots of infantry out to patrol the Levels, anyway. But with a plane-crash scenario you wouldn't get to issue them with live ammo or with orders to shoot or to call in mortar strikes. What you have to hope is that the PCs will shoot and kill a bunch of unarmed soldiers. When that happens you announce that terrorists are trying to steal the bombs off the plane, issue a terrorist alert, issue live ammo, etc. That's sad. People being friendly won't issue suicidal orders such as ordering that multi-million pound bits of kit be crashed into hills. Field fortifications like that are much less effective at channelling infiltrators than they are at channelling assaults. I wouldn't count on them to have much effect. That isn't feasible. The Well is in a walled garden surrounded by other buildings: shops and so forth. There is lots of blocking cover all around it. And lines of sight from the top of the Tor are, as I recollect, close off by a belt of trees as well. You had better put a platoon of armoured infantry outside the garden and a patrol of SAS inside. Mobile machine-gun turrets? Use [i]Warrior[/i] AIFVs. They give you a 30mm cannon, a 7.62mm chaingun, smokescreens. And you get four with each platoon of armoured infantry. [/QUOTE]
